Some of the highest-paying IT jobs are those that require the most education, credentials, or experience, such as vice president of technology or IT manager. Many senior-level professionals in the United States make over six figures. The US Bureau of Labor Statistics BLS projects information technology jobs to grow between and , creating an estimated average of , openings annually [ 2 ]. Where you sit in the organizational chart matters as well. Vice presidents and C-suite executives will make more money than an entry-level developer, and an IT architect will make more money than a consultant.
